How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Waikiki?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Waikiki Studio Apartments | $1,746 | $1,200 | $2,495 |
| Waikiki 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,358 | $1,395 | $7,036 |
| Waikiki 2 Bedroom Apartments | $7,923 | $2,195 | $10,000+ |
| Waikiki 3 Bedroom Apartments | $21,265 | $3,395 | $10,000+ |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Waikiki?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$3,832 | $2,100 | $7,500 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$4,374 | $2,500 | $8,550 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$15,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Waikiki
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Waikiki area of Honolulu, HI?
As of today, July 27, 2026, there are currently 645 available Waikiki apartments priced from $1,200 to $30,403, with an average monthly rent of $3,581.
How much are Studio apartments in Waikiki?
There are currently 365 Studio Apartments in Waikiki with rent ranges from $1,200 to $2,495 with an average price of $1,746.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Waikiki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Waikiki ranges from $1,395 to $7,036 with an average monthly rent of $3,358.
